Taiwan’s Foxconn, the world’s largest contract electronics maker, reported Thursday that its second-quarter working revenue rose 27% 12 months over 12 months, on the power of its rising synthetic intelligence server enterprise.
This is how Foxconn did within the second quarter of 2025 in contrast with LSEG SmartEstimates, that are weighted towards forecasts from analysts who’re extra constantly correct:
- Income: 1.79 trillion New Taiwan {dollars} ($59.73 billion) vs. NT$1.79 trillion
- Working revenue: NT$56.596 billion vs. NT$49.767 billion
Second quarter income grew 16% from final 12 months, coming consistent with LSEG’s SmartEstimates. The corporate’s internet revenue for the second quarter got here in at NT$44.36 billion, beating expectations of NT$38.81 billion.
Foxconn, formally referred to as Hon Hai Precision Trade, is the world’s largest producer of Apple’s iPhones, and has been seeking to replicate its success in client electronics on this planet of AI.
The agency manufactures server racks designed for AI workloads and has grow to be a key companion to American AI chip darling Nvidia.
Gross sales of Foxconn’s server merchandise made up the lion’s share of revenues within the second quarter at 41%, surpassing its sensible client digital merchandise for the primary time, which accounted for 35%.
In an earnings report, the corporate forecasted that its AI server enterprise would proceed to drive progress into the present quarter, with income anticipated to extend by over 170% 12 months over 12 months.
Foxconn stated earlier this month that it anticipated total income to develop additional within the third quarter, however famous that the affect of “evolving world political and financial situations” could be intently monitored.
On the finish of July, Foxconn introduced that it was taking a stake in industrial motor maker TECO Electrical & Equipment in a strategic partnership to construct extra AI knowledge facilities.
The corporate has additionally proven its willingness to broaden into new areas, together with the meeting of electrical autos and the manufacturing of semiconductors.
Nevertheless, U.S. President Donald Trump’s world tariffs may affect Foxconn’s outlook this 12 months. In response to Trump’s tariff threats, the corporate has already moved most of its ultimate manufacturing of made-for-the-U.S. iPhones to India.
Taiwan has been hit with a 20% “momentary tariff” from the U.S., with negotiations stated to be ongoing.
